Who Do You Trust on the Web?

It seems pornographers have the same problems as any other businesses once they gain a bad reputation. Pretty much everyone is wary of porn websites because of the bad practices of some. The U.S. industry generally, anxious to hold on to the 40 million Americans who view pages with adult content regularly, have made great efforts to ensure their sites are free from scams and malware. So successful have they been that a Web Of Trust blog  tells us that while 'adult entertainment websites' account for 12% of the total number of web pages (1 in 6) a study has found that there are 99 infected mainstream web pages for every one infected adult web page, making the safety ratio 99:1. It seems those of us who avoid adult websites and think we're safe shouldn't be so complacent.
Web Of Trust or WOT is a great way to use the wisdom of crowds as a guide to websites. You can download it as an app for various browsers and better still join WOT and register your own scores and comments on the websites you visit.
